Accuitive Medical Ventures

Accuitive Medical Ventures, established in 2003, is a venture capital firm based in Duluth, Georgia. It specializes in financing and supporting early and expansion-stage medical device and technology companies in the United States.

Halscion

Debt Financing in 2012
Founded in 2005, Halscion specializes in developing biocompatible hydrogel scaffolds designed to improve wound healing and reduce scarring. These single-use devices are applied during surgeries at the dermal-subdermal interface of wounds by injection, allowing the patient's own cells to organize and propagate into the wound.
